Is The Grove at Pinemont Apartment Homes Safe?
It's average — crime is comparable to the national average. The Grove at Pinemont Apartment Homes in Houston, TX has a safety grade of C. The overall crime index is 170, which is 70% above the national average of 100.
Compared to the Houston average (crime index 109), The Grove at Pinemont Apartment Homes is 61% higher in overall crime. Residents and visitors should exercise extra caution in this area, particularly after dark.
Looking at specific crime types, robbery is the most elevated concern (index: 195, 95% above average), while rape is the lowest risk (index: 118).
